It is a rare thing for me to paint someone I know - honestly, I'm usually traveling alone, so everyone's a stranger. But on this occasion, inside the Smithsonian American Art Museum, I caught a glimpse of my boyfriend underneath the massive mural 'Achelous and Hercules', painted by Thomas Hart Benton - an artist we both have a great affection for. When I was around 15 years old, I convinced my art teacher and the principal of the school to allow me to paint a 50 foot by 2 foot mural in the hallway - depicting American history events. A large portion of it was painted much like Benton - those recognizable, exaggerated figures with vivid colors. It got me out of gym class for three months, which was my intention in the first place.
